Amanda,
Is it possible that the SBS 2000 domain is a "single domain name" like
DOMAIN, and not a "Complex domain name" like domain.local?
Make sure to Install ADMT on SBS2000 and follow the same steps to move the
accounts.
Please make sure the DNS Forwarders on both SBS are pointing to each other
per the
migration paper.
